Front Door With Window: A Comprehensive Guide
When it concerns enhancing the curb appeal and performance of a home, the choice of a front door substantially affects the total visual. One popular alternative that property owners often consider is the front door with a window. This post offers an extensive expedition of front doors featuring windows, detailing their advantages, style alternatives, materials, and considerations for setup.
Comprehending Front Doors with Windows
Front doors with windows can be found in numerous styles and products, providing an excellent mix of aesthetics and functionality. These doors normally feature glass panels that can be designed in different sizes, shapes, and styles, enabling natural light to light up the entryway while offering a clear view of the exterior.
Benefits of Front Doors with Windows
Choosing a front door with a window offers several advantages:
- Natural Light: The primary advantage is the increase of natural light. This can make the entranceway bright and welcoming.
- Visibility: Windows in front doors often provide exposure to the outdoors world, enhancing awareness of visitors before unlocking.
- Aesthetic Appeal: A front door with a window can work as a declaration piece, add character to your home, and enhance the general architectural style.
- Air flow: Some styles enable ventilation, enhancing air flow in the entrance.
- Security Features: Modern front doors with windows often feature tempered glass or other security features to deter break-ins.

Materials Used in Front Doors with Windows
When thinking about a front door with a window, the material is critical for durability, insulation, and maintenance. Here are some commonly utilized materials:
1. Fiberglass
- Extremely recommended due to energy efficiency.
- Resistant to warping and can mimic the appearance of wood.
- Low maintenance requirements.
2. Wood
- Offers classic appeal and heat.
- Requires routine maintenance (staining or painting) to prevent weather damage.
- Various kinds of wood can provide unique visual appeals.
3. Steel
- Offers high security and sturdiness.
- More resistant to effect than wood or fiberglass.
- Minimal design versatility however can be tailored.
4. Vinyl
- Affordable and energy-efficient.
- Low upkeep and available in lots of styles.
- Generally, not as aesthetically appealing as wood or fiberglass.
Table: Comparison of Front Door Materials
Material | Resilience | Maintenance | Expense | Insulation Efficiency | Visual Appeal |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Fiberglass | High | Low | Moderate | Outstanding | Flexible |
Wood | Moderate | High | High | Moderate | High |
Steel | High | Low | Moderate | Moderate | Moderate |
Vinyl | Moderate | Low | Low | Good | Moderate |
Installation Considerations
When installing a front door with a window, several elements must be thought about:
- Professional vs. DIY: While some house owners may select a DIY setup, working with a professional makes sure that the door is properly fitted and sealed, avoiding drafts or leaks.
- Regulatory Guidelines: Compliance with regional building regulations concerning glass setup is essential for security.
- Weather condition Stripping: Ensure proper weather removing is used around the door to enhance energy performance.
- Security Measures: Choose doors with safe locks and consider reinforcing windows with laminated glass or ornamental grilles.
- Upkeep Plan: Depending on the material selected, an upkeep plan must be established to maintain the door's condition and appearance.
FAQs
1. Are front doors with windows more expensive than solid doors?
- Typically, front doors with windows can be more expensive due to the additional products and style intricacy. Nevertheless, cost varies widely based upon the product and manufacturer.
2. How do I clean up the glass on my front door?
- Utilize a soft cloth and a quality glass cleaner. Avoid abrasive products that might scratch the glass surface.
3. Can I change a solid door with a door that has windows?
- Yes, replacing a strong door with a front door with windows is possible, however structural adjustments may be needed.
4. Do front doors with windows supply sufficient security?
- Modern doors with windows are designed with safety in mind. Try to find tempered glass options and robust locking mechanisms to boost security.
